Banana Egg Pancakes


Today I get to share with you my favorite 
weekend breakfast: Banana Egg Pancakes

They are very healthy and easy to make!  
You mix together two eggs and one banana (per person). 
Pour small amounts into a greased frying pan over medium-low.  
You will want to keep an eye on them and flip as needed.

 If you have a thing for sweets like I do you can add a couple of chocolate chips.  
This is definitely a favorite for my husband too!
